Output 98538d0e59e907a0187650dc04afc3b970fc1c17ba75519ed2584590f02f443a:12

value
12626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 7d7521e4ec8aabc2c0e06f76b304f31fad9921792e85e86ebd776a3de69cc4cf
address
bc1p046jre8v324u9s8qdamtxp8nr7kejgte96z7sm4awa4rme5ucn8s8px2sl
transaction
98538d0e59e907a0187650dc04afc3b970fc1c17ba75519ed2584590f02f443a
spent
true